2022 Triumph Rocket 3 R

Specifications
- Category
- Custom / cruiser
- Displacement
- 2458.0 ccm (149.99 cubic inches)
- Engine
- Counter rotating crankshaft
- Power
- 165.0 HP (120.4 kW) @ 6000 RPM
- Torque
- 221.0 Nm (22.5 kgf-m or 163.0 ft.lbs) @ 4000 RPM
The 2022 Triumph Rocket 3 R
2022 Triumph Rocket 3 R sits at the top of Triumph's power-cruiser range, built around the largest production motorcycle engine on the market and aimed at riders who want brute torque over sport-bike agility. This is a bike that pulls hard from idle in any gear, making highway passing and stoplight launches almost comically easy without needing to wring out the throttle. The counter-rotating crankshaft cancels out the torque reaction you'd expect from an engine this size, so the massive low-end pull doesn't try to twist the bike sideways under acceleration. It's a machine built for muscle rather than lean angle, more comfortable eating up straight roads than carving canyons. The 2022 model carried over without significant mechanical changes from the prior year — buyers comparing it to a 2021 example should focus on mileage, service history, and condition rather than spec differences. Owners tend to be experienced riders coming from Harley-Davidson or Ducati XDiavel territory, drawn to the novelty of the displacement figure as much as the performance itself. Collector interest remains moderate, with early low-mileage examples of the 2022 Triumph Rocket 3 R holding attention among enthusiasts who value engineering oddities over outright rarity.
